The ramp construction for the Bangalore Metro Green Line’s Reach 3C project alongside Tumkur Road has been completed. Steel girders which is 53 metres in length has been constructed with regard to the ramp construction.
The Rs 298.65 crore project had been bagged by Simplex in February 2017. The project was envisioned to be completed in 2 years however there were constraints which had cropped up pertaining to finance and procurement of land from the Nandi Infrastructure Corridor Enterprise. Nagasandra is connected to Madavar via this project. 3 stations including Manjunathnagar, Chikkabidarakallu and Madavar feature along this line.
Whereas Manjunathnagar and Chikkabidarakallu are in advanced stages and the stations are nearly completed, work around the Madavar station is still in nascent stages as the construction began at a much later stage.
The steel girders have bridged 3 spans that lie between the Chikkabidarakallu and Madavar stations. This was required as they lie in an elevation in comparison to the other 85 spans.
